One of the key findings of a market study on aliments lyophilisés is the increasing popularity of freeze-dried fruits and vegetables. These products are widely favored for their convenience and nutrition, as they provide a quick and easy way to add healthy ingredients to meals and snacks. Freeze-dried fruits and vegetables are also popular among health-conscious consumers looking for natural and wholesome food options. With the rise of plant-based diets and clean eating trends, freeze-dried fruits and vegetables are expected to continue growing in popularity in the coming years.

In addition to fruits and vegetables, freeze-dried meat and seafood products are also gaining traction in the market. These products offer a convenient and shelf-stable protein source for consumers, making them an attractive option for outdoor enthusiasts, travelers, and busy professionals. Freeze-dried meat and seafood products are often used in camping, hiking, and emergency preparedness kits, as they are lightweight, easy to store, and have a long shelf life. With the increasing demand for on-the-go and portable food options, freeze-dried meat and seafood products are expected to see continued growth in the market.
